Mastering Armor Angling on Obj 257

Sep 30, 2024

Hey tankers! Ready to up your game with the Obj 257? One of the key strategies to master is armor angling. Properly angling your armor can significantly increase your tank's survivability on the battlefield. Here's how to do it: The frontal armor of the Obj 257 is already tough, but when angled correctly, it becomes nearly impenetrable. When facing an opponent, try to angle your tank at about a 30-45 degree angle to the left or right. This will increase the effective thickness of your armor and make it more difficult for enemy shells to penetrate. Keep in mind that angling too much can expose your weaker side armor, so finding the right balance is crucial. Additionally, be mindful of your positioning. You should try to take advantage of natural cover or terrain to further enhance your angling and minimize the chances of taking hits. Furthermore, always try to keep your turret facing directly at your opponent, as the turret front is also well-armored and can bounce shots when angled properly. Lastly, practice makes perfect. Spend time in battles experimenting with different angles and observing how enemy shots interact with your armor. Learning to angle effectively will take some time, but once mastered, it can turn you into an incredibly resilient force on the battlefield.
